I am trying to create this formula;
FL=C * Q2/100 * L/100
Where;
FL is Friction Loss
C is a varying Coeficient
Q is a varying Quantity in Litres divided by 100(then Squared)
L is Length in Meters divided by 100
C can equal 24.5 for 45mm
C can equal 3.17 for 65mm
C can equal .305 for 100mm
